A PROVINCIAL board member on Monday gave this “solution” to the problem on illegal gambling: stop the Philippine Charity Sweepstakes Office’s “Suertres” lotto operations for at least one year.

Boris Olivier Actub proposed that Misamis Oriental board pass a resolution to officially request PCSO to suspend its Suertres operations which, he said, is a remedy to stop the prolificacy of illegal number games in the country, especially in northern Mindanao.

But Actub’s motion was immediately killed by the provincial board–not one member seconded it.

Actub said it was the third time for his colleagues to reject his proposed resolution. He admitted that his proposal was like “shooting for the stars.”

Actub also called on the PCSO to investigate into allegations that people in government, including local officials and police officers, have long been serving as protectors of illegal gambling operators.

Misamis Oriental Gov. Yevgeny Vincente Emano said the illegal Suertres operations in the province made legitimate lotto revenues drop from P1 million to P750 thousand a day.

Eddie Go, vice president of organize lotto agents, told local radio that the capitol has shown no significant action to address their problem.

“Ang paggamay sa kita sa mga lotto outlets tungod sa illegal gambling,” said Go.

He said what was needed was a “Tokhang”-like campaign against illegal gambling operations in the province.

Emano said he would create a task force to go after those behind the illegal gambling operations.
